    We visited Hong Kong this past Friday afternoon for an early dinner. It is to go only which is fine. The back of house is still closed off from the front via plexiglass and a window box to receive your food. I assume this is leftover from COVID-19. We ordered via the qMenu app which was quick and easy and allowed for payment on pickup. I arrived and the food was finished and ready for pickup. Pickup was quick and easy. We ordered a sweet and sour chicken combo with chicken fried rice and and egg roll, a small sweet and sour chicken, a teriyaki chicken combo with chicken fried rice and egg roll and an order of small beef lo mein. I'll just say, other than the food being hot I can't say that we were very impressed. The food was fresh but almost everything was lacking in flavor. The sweet and sour chicken was hot and fresh but the sauce was not as good as others that I have had. The chicken was all white meat and the coating was done to perfection, but bland as can be and the sauce lacking as it did, couldn't save it. My wife's teriyaki chicken again was hot and fresh but lacking in flavor. There was a good amount of sauce to it, but didn't add much in the way of flavor. The chicken fried rice, again hot and fresh but no real flavor. It did have a good amount of white meat chicken in it though which is a plus. The egg rolls in the combos as well, sound like a broken record here, but hot and fresh with not much flavor. Some seasoning would be a great addition to all of the food. Maybe they have had complaints in the past of items being too spicy or salty etc and have adapted to those thoughts. Who knows but flavor that food up. The only redeeming food item was the beef lo mein. My wife had that as well and said that it was very tasty and she enjoyed it quite a bit. It is a toss up as to whether or not we would try this restaurant again.
